Canceling vs Deleting Your Netflix Account: What’s the Difference?
Canceling and deleting your Netflix account might sound the same, but it’s not. First, canceling your Netflix account means you will no longer be able to watch movies and TV shows on the platform after your current billing cycle ends. The good thing is that Netflix no longer charges you monthly unless you restart your subscription. However, your account is still available on Netflix’s servers and you can still log in.
On the other hand, deleting your Netflix account means your data will be removed from the company’s servers. After your account has been deleted, you will no longer be able to log in. And if you want to subscribe to Netflix in the future, you’ll need to create a new account.
However, it’s good to note that Netflix will delete your account after ten months simply by canceling your subscription. Unfortunately, unlike deleting your Netflix profile, account deletion is not a quick and straightforward process.
How to delete your Netflix account after canceling your subscription
If you wish to delete your Netflix account, you must first cancel your subscription if you still have one. There are different ways to cancel your Netflix subscription, depending on whether you subscribed directly or through a third party. Luckily, we’ve covered all the ways to cancel your Netflix subscription — on different devices.
When you are done with that, follow these steps to delete your account:
- Contact Netflix Support by sending an email to [email protected] You must use the same email address that you used for your Netflix account.
- Use “Request account deletion” as the subject of the email.
You may have to wait a few days before hearing from the company. Keep in mind that if you request to delete your account before the end of your current billing cycle after termination, Netflix will delete your account after billing expires. Otherwise, if you want the company to delete your account immediately, be explicit about it in your email.
Does Netflix keep your information after account deletion?
Netflix will delete your account, but it won’t delete any information related to you. A Netflix support page says so“We retain limited information after account deletion for lawful reasons, including for fraud prevention, billing purposes and to enforce our Terms of Service.” The limited information in question includes your email address, device identifier and your payment details (in encrypted form).
